A climbing rose, White Eden Climber® grows vigorously, its strong, arching canes reaching 10 to 12 feet tall and 4 feet wide. White Eden flowers in large, romantic clusters of 5-inch, old-fashioned blooms with 100 to 110 ruffled petals. The blooms repeat throughout the season, from late spring to late fall.
White Eden Climber is a disease resistant, highly versatile rose that can be grown on trellises, poles, arches, and pillars, trained along fences or walls, or allowed to fountain on its own.
